Warranty
If you are thinking about purchasing a treadmill, it is crucial to look into the warranty. A good warranty will save you money if the treadmill needs to be repaired or replaced. A good warranty will cover all major components and even the cost of labor. Some treadmills offer a lifetime warranty, while others only have a one-year warranty. It's important to be aware of the warranties each company provides.
The first thing to look at when reviewing a treadmill's warranty is the electronics and parts coverage. This is because it will determine if the machine can be repaired. A lot of treadmills that are cheap have 90 days of warranty on parts and electronics. A good warranty should last from 2 to 5 years, based on the manufacturer.
The next thing you should do is verify the warranty on the frame. A weak frame can ruin your workout and pose an accident hazard. A good frame warranty should last 10 to 15 years. Where to purchase
If you're seeking a treadmill to keep yourself fit at home or if you're following the 12-3-30 method or are just trying to get your legs back from an injuries, there are plenty of options available. There are treadmills that are affordable enough for moderate use, or premium machines that will help you increase your speed and endurance.
It's important to consider the kind of workout you'd like to perform as well as the frequency you'll use the treadmill. This will help you determine how much horsepower you require. Many brands advertise the 'peak' horsepower, which is great for marketing but it's better to focus on the continuous horsepower, which is what you'll actually be getting from the motor.
The physical dimensions of the treadmill is another factor to consider, especially in the event that you're limited on space in your home. It's worth measuring your space to make sure that the machine fits, and be careful to factor in any clearance needed for mounting/dismounting. Another thing to take into consideration is the maximum user weight. If you're a serious runner, you'll want the machine is able to handle the challenge and can withstand the stress of training.
